Industry Pain Point: Incomplete Separation Affects Final Product Quality

In tuber starch processing and industrial solid-liquid separation, traditional sedimentation and ordinary filtering equipment lack sufficient separation capacity. Fine solid particles cannot be fully intercepted, resulting in solid entrainment in liquid and excessive residual moisture in solid phase.

Incomplete separation leads to high moisture content and excessive impurities in finished starch. A large amount of valuable solid material is lost in filtrate, causing raw material waste. Unstable separation purity interferes with downstream refining, dewatering and drying processes, resulting in inconsistent batch quality and failure to meet export and food-grade standards. Conventional equipment struggles with fluctuating slurry concentration and cannot maintain stable separation performance.

Core Advantages of Scraper Centrifuge for High Purity Separation

The Scraper Centrifuge adopts high-speed centrifugal sedimentation combined with precision screen and mechanical scraper structure to achieve high-precision solid-liquid separation.

Powerful centrifugal force separates solid and liquid by density difference rapidly, intercepting fine particles effectively and improving filtrate clarity. The precision scraper discharges filter cake smoothly without damaging material structure, maintaining stable internal working conditions even with slight slurry fluctuation.

The fully enclosed design avoids external contamination and ensures consistent separation accuracy. With high separation efficiency, controllable cake moisture and low solid content in filtrate, it reduces material loss and stabilizes product quality, perfectly suitable for standardized continuous production of starch and other industrial materials.

Selection Guidelines for High-Purity Scraper Centrifuge
  • Choose high-precision graded Scraper Centrifuge for fine particle interception.
  • Select precision filter screen with proper mesh to balance permeability and separation accuracy.
  • Adopt variable-frequency speed regulation to adapt to changing slurry concentration.
  • Check overall sealing performance to prevent material leakage and ensure separation purity.
  • Match model specification according to production capacity and material characteristics for long-term stable operation.
